The drive from Waukee, IA to Burlington, IA covers 184.8 miles and takes about 3h 39m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on IA 163, IA 5, US 34 for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 77.6 miles on IA 163. At current regular gas prices, budget about $28.89 one way before food or hotel costs.

This is a 3h 39m highway drive covering 184.8 miles, with most of the trip on IA 163 and IA 5. The longest continuous stretch is about 77.6 miles on IA 163.
This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on IA 163 and IA 5. This route has several spots where lane changes, forks, or exits need your full attention. The trickiest moment comes around 0.2 miles in near US 6 / Hickman Road.
